查看mysql日志内容

原创
admin 3周前 (08-20) 阅读数 85 #MySQL
文章标签 MySQL

查看MySQL日志内容

MySQL日志是数据库运行过程中非常重要的组成部分,通过查看日志内容,我们可以了解到数据库的运行状态、性能以及或许存在的问题。本文将介绍怎样查看MySQL日志内容,并对常见日志文件进行解析。

一、MySQL日志类型

MySQL重点包含以下几种日志类型:

  1. 不正确日志(Error Log)
  2. 查询日志(General Query Log)
  3. 慢查询日志(Slow Query Log)
  4. 二进制日志(Binary Log)
  5. 中继日志(Relay Log)

二、查看不正确日志

不正确日志记录了MySQL数据库运行过程中出现的不正确信息,可以帮助我们定位问题。以下为查看不正确日志内容的方法:

  1. 找到MySQL的不正确日志文件,通常位于MySQL安装目录的data目录下,文件名为hostname.err。
  2. 使用文本编辑器(如Notepad++、Sublime Text等)打开不正确日志文件。

三、查看查询日志

查询日志记录了所有对数据库的操作,包括查询、更新、删除等。以下为查看查询日志内容的方法:

  1. 找到MySQL的查询日志文件,通常位于MySQL安装目录的data目录下,文件名为hostname.log。
  2. 使用文本编辑器打开查询日志文件。

四、查看慢查询日志

慢查询日志记录了执行时间超过指定阈值的查询操作。以下为查看慢查询日志内容的方法:

  1. 找到MySQL的慢查询日志文件,通常位于MySQL安装目录的data目录下,文件名为hostname-slow.log。
  2. 使用文本编辑器打开慢查询日志文件。

五、查看二进制日志

二进制日志记录了数据库的所有变更操作,用于数据恢复和主从复制。以下为查看二进制日志内容的方法:

  1. 使用MySQL命令行客户端登录数据库。
  2. 执行以下命令查看二进制日志列表:

SHOW BINARY LOGS;

  1. 使用以下命令查看指定二进制日志的内容:

SHOW BINLOG EVENTS IN 'log_name';

六、总结

通过查看MySQL日志内容,我们可以了解数据库的运行状态,发现并解决潜在问题。在实际工作中,熟练掌握各种日志的查看方法对数据库的维护至关重要。


本文由IT视界版权所有,禁止未经同意的情况下转发

热门